- Summary:
- Stokowski discusses acoustics and advances in recording engineering; surround sound for homes; and varying arrangements of musicians on the concert stage to take advantage of acoustics in the hall.
- Notes:
- Broadcast on WNCN during the intermission of the Cleveland Orchestra program on June 20, 1971.
- Original copy: Cassette tape 7; preservation copy: one 10 1/2 in. reel to reel tape 10; service copy: one compact disk CD 010. Preservation and service copies recorded October and November 2000.
